摘要
JACK(TM) is an implementation of the Belief/Desire/Intention model of rational agency with extensions to support the design and execution of agent systems where team structures, real-time control, repeatability and linkage with legacy code are critical. This chapter presents the JACK(TM) multi-agent systems platform. The chapter begins with a discussion of agent programming concepts as they relate to JACK(TM), and then presents experiences from the development of two industrial applications that made use of JACK(TM) (a meteorological alerting environment and a responsive manufacturing set-up).
